Classification of Cohen-Macaulay $t$-spread lexsegment ideals via simplicial complexes
Marilena Crupi, Antonino Ficarra

Abstract
We study the minimal primary decomposition of completely -spread lexsegment ideals via simplicial complexes. We determine some algebraic invariants of such a class of -spread ideals. Hence, we classify all -spread lexsegment ideals which are Cohen-Macaulay.
